Zubimendi a worthy stand-in for Spain's Rodri

Denmark goalkeeper Kasper Schmeichel was left red-faced as a second-half strike by midfielder Martin Zubimendi gave an injury-hit Spain a 1-0 win in the Nations League on Oct 12.

Missing seven of the starters who beat England 2-1 in the Euro 2024 final in July, Spain dominated proceedings in Murcia but it was not until the 79th minute that they managed to find the winner as Zubimendi netted his first goal for his country.
The Real Sociedad midfielder unleashed a first-time shot from the edge of the box that deflected off a defender before squirming under Schmeichel, who should have kept it out.
It helped justify coach Luis de la Fuente's pre-match comments that Zubimendi was the second-best holding midfielder in the world, after the injured Rodri.
De la Fuente added after the match: "With his goal the attention will go up but his play, the fact that he's got a computer in his brain means we are privileged to have him at a time when Rodri will be out for a while."
